Kimi K3 topped Arena’s coding leaderboard in 24 hours. Trump advisor Sacks warned the US is losing. Khosla blamed immigration. A Wall Street CIO called it bad news for closed AI labs.
Moonshot AI’s Kimi K3 topped Arena’s frontend coding leaderboard within 24 hours of launch, ahead of Anthropic’s Claude Fable 5 and OpenAI’s GPT-5.6 Sol. It placed third on Artificial Analysis’s Intelligence Index. The reaction from Washington, Wall Street, and academia was swift and pointed. TNW covered the model’s capabilities at launch, but the political and economic fallout is a story of its own.
David Sacks, Trump’s former AI czar and current cochair of the President’s Council of Advisors on Science and Technology, called the release “concerning” and said it was the first time a Chinese model had taken the top coding spot.
